3 STAINLESS STEELARMCO NITRONIC 50 STAINLESS STEEL1 Product DescriptionAK Steel s ARMCO NITRONIC 50 Stainless Steel provides a combination of corrosion resistance and strength not found in any other commercial material available in its price range. This austenitic stainless steel has corrosion resistance greater than that provided by Types 316, 316L, 317, and 317L, plus approximately twice the yield strength at room temperature. In addition, AK Steel s ARMCO NITRONIC 50 Stainless Steel has very good mechanical properties at both elevated and subzero temperatures.
4 Unlike many austenitic stainless steels, ARMCO NITRONIC 50 does not become magnetic when cold worked or cooled to sub-zero temperatures. 5 It can be supplied annealed at 1066 1121 C (1950 2050 F). For most applications, the 1066 C (1950 F) condition should be selected, as it provides a higher level of mechanical properties along with excellent corrosion resistance. When as-welded material is to be used in strongly corrosive media, the 1121 C (2050 F) condition should be specified in order to minimize the possibility of intergranular STRENGTH (HS) CONDITIONThe superior strength of ARMCO NITRONIC 50 Stainless Steel bars is due to special hot rolling and is size-dependent, approaching that of annealed bars with sizes over mm (3 in.)
